    This 3rd installment of the Kobalt 3 draw work bench make over many more upgrades get added. This builds on the two prior videos that added casters and then lowered the bottom shelf for a lot more space. Here we added lower doors utilizing more of the 3/4" hardwood flooring pieces with a plywood back plate. Special adjustable auto closing hinges were used. Here is a link to Amazon: www.amazon.com... Also added a drop leaf extension on the left side of the Kobalt bench/cart with more of the same technique and the top and doors. Wire management for the power cables and the 3 piece stereo speaker system (2 speakers hidden in the top bin and subwoofer in the lower cabinet) was completed. The pegboard got lots of attention with a collection of magnetic pans, racks and 18" strips most from Harbor Freight. The last big update was creating an adapter to quickly remove a full size IRWIN 5" bench vise so to not take up a lot of acreage on the bench top.
